[SPARK-1468] Modify the partition function used by partitionBy.
Make partitionBy use a tweaked version of hash as its default partition function since the python hash function does not consistently assign the same value to None across python processes. diff --git a/python/pyspark/rdd.py b/python/pyspark/rdd.py
index f3b1f1a665..1b3c460dd6 100644
--- a/python/pyspark/rdd.py
+++ b/python/pyspark/rdd.py
@@ -1062,7 +1062,7 @@ class RDD(object):
return python_right_outer_join(self, other, numPartitions)
# TODO: add option to control map-side combining
- def partitionBy(self, numPartitions, partitionFunc=hash):
+ def partitionBy(self, numPartitions, partitionFunc=None):
"""
Return a copy of the RDD partitioned using the specified partitioner.
@@ -1073,6 +1073,9 @@ class RDD(object):
"""
if numPartitions is None:
numPartitions = self.ctx.defaultParallelism
+
+ if partitionFunc is None:
+ partitionFunc = lambda x: 0 if x is None else hash(x)
# Transferring O(n) objects to Java is too expensive. Instead, we'll
# form the hash buckets in Python, transferring O(numPartitions) objects
# to Java. Each object is a (splitNumber, [objects]) pair.
